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Ausfeld's Wattle | Gelert's Dandelion |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) |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ers) |
| Family | Fabaceae |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) |
| Genus | Acacia | Taraxacum |
| Species | Acacia ausfeldii | Taraxacum gelertii |
Evolutionary Relationship
Ausfeld's Wattle and Gelert's Dandelion share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
